Outcome: Consultation complete. Draft results being presented to senior officers for further discussion and actions arising. Nearly all of the organisations responding (90.2%) wanted to be involved in preparing the Local Development Framework and fourfifths (81%) wanted to be consulted about planning applications. The organisations were asked whether they would be prepared to join with others to discuss common issues and develop ideas with Borough Council officers. Again, nearly all respondents (90.3%) were willing to do this, although concern was expressed by one supportive organisation that meetings might be held at short notice. Another stressed the need to ensure that organisations of disabled people are fully engaged by making all events inclusive and independently accessible by all.
